The ionization constants of carboxylic acids can be routinely obtained by pH measurements. 28,36 … ipswich dialysis unitWebHydrofluoric acid has a Ka value of 6.3 times 10 to the negative fourth, and acetic acid has a Ka value of 1.8 times 10 to the negative fifth. Since both of these have Ka values less than one, they're both considered to be weak acids.
